Panasonic Readies 3D Projection System

By | news_and_media | No Comments

Panasonic is developing a 3D projection system for the commercial market that will launch this summer, the company announced Tuesday on its Critical View blog. The PT-DJ3D53 system will be offered to military and education customers, as well as restaurants and sports bars. It will feature two PT-DW530U DLP projectors, and does require glasses.

DIRECTV Testing Home Media Center

By | news_and_media | No Comments

May 18, 2011 Click here to view the full article http://www.customretailer.net/article/directv-testing-home-media-center-25018080/1?sponsor=newsletter/cr-e-weekly&e=chantal%40audioimpact.com#utm_source=cr-e-weekly&utm_medium=enewsletter_headline&utm_campaign=2011-05-23 DIRECTV said this week that it has launched field testing for its new Home Media Center product. The product uses RVU technology and will allow for “receiver-less” TV viewing, the company said. “The DIRECTV Home Media Center is going to simplify the way our customers watch television throughout their homes and give them access not only to their favorite content in HD and DVR…
